- The distance between Hightstown, Nj, Usa and Cervia, Italy is approximately 6,859 km or 4,262 mi.
- To reach Hightstown, Nj in this distance one would set out from Cervia bearing 299.6°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Hightstown, Nj bearing 234.4° or SW .
- Both have a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Hightstown, Nj is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ome whereas Cervia is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 1.7 °C (3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 5.7 °C (10.3°F) more in Hightstown, Nj.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 478.1 mm (18.8 in) more which is equivalent to 478.1 l/m² (11.73 US gal/ft²) or 4,781,000 l/ha (511,121 US gal/ac) more. About 1 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 4.2° higher in Hightstown, Nj than in Cervia.
